- Title
C−H Bond Activation Relay (CHAR) of Proline Ester Derivatives Promoted by In Situ Triarylamine Radical Cation: Selective Synthesis of 4‐Bromopyrrole Derivatives.
- Authors
Ding, Han; Zhang, Shuwei; Sun, Zheng; Ma, Qiyuan; Li, Yuemei; Yuan, Yu; Jia, Xiaodong
- Abstract
Using the in situ generated triarylamine radical cation as an initiator, the sp3 C−H bond of proline esters was smoothly oxidized and brominated through C−H activation relay (CHAR), giving a series of 4‐bromopyrroles in good yields with high regioselectivity. The mechanistic study revealed that the oxidation of the active C−H bond initiated the followed 1,5‐HAT and bromination, which provides a new method to realize the functionalization of the remote C−H bond.
